Although most of us have a corkscrew in the kitchen, we remain largely unaware of the many different types and designs of corkscrews that have been developed over the last three hundred years. Since the 18th century, inventors have devised increasingly ingenious methods of removing corks from bottles of wine, beer, champagne, perfume, and medicine, using the laws of physics, the skills of mechanical engineering, the science of new materials, and the artistic aspects of design.

This book reveals the divers and amazing corkscrews that have been created over the years and aims to spur the reader on to collecting these fascinating and useful items.

Written with the beginner collector in mind, the book starts with the most basic corkscrews and works through the different types, explaining the mechanisms that pull out the cork. Examples given include the more common, easily found pieces, but also includes the rarer pieces the colloctor can aspire to obtain.
